
William III Shilling, 1697, third bust
William III (1694-1702), silver Shilling, 1697, third laureate and draped bust right, legend and toothed border surrounding, GVLIELMVS. III.DEI.GRA, rev. crowned cruciform shields, Lion of Nassau at centre, date either side of top crown, .MAG BR.FRA ET.HIB REX. weight 6.10g (Bull 1128; ESC 1102; S.3505). Toned, dark in places with some light flan adjustment marks across obverse, much less so than usually seen, otherwise a pleasing extremely fine.
